Original Title: Stretch Country: India, USA Year: 2014 Genre: Comedy, Thriller Director: Joe Carnahan Writer: Joe Carnahan , Jerry Corley Production: Universal Pictures, Blumhouse Productions, Chambara Pictures Distribution: Koch Media Runtime: 1h 30 Min 44 Sec Cast: Patrick Wilson, Ed Helms, James Badge Dale, Brooklyn Decker, Jessica Alba
Language: Italian English Subtitles i Italian German
.: PLOT :. A hard-luck limo driver struggles to go straight and pay off a debt to his bookie. He takes on a job with a crazed passenger, whose sought-after ledger implicates some seriously dangerous criminals. .
